Output ec825075785969a318ad5666bbc4fb128cd60510f3a967458ce159895bdc39fa:0

value
4200000000
script pubkey
OP_PUSHBYTES_33 0388f89a7eb057270428e4f8845d320c377ba9d5922ebfc24718d40d9c582f656c OP_CHECKSIG
transaction
ec825075785969a318ad5666bbc4fb128cd60510f3a967458ce159895bdc39fa